Megan Rapinoe, captain of the US women’s soccer team and everyone’s summer crush, now has a book deal! She’ll be writing an adult nonfiction book for Penguin, which “will include anecdotes from Ms. Rapinoe’s life,” as well as a middle-grade book for Razorbill, speaking to “the power young people have within their own communities and the world at large.”
The former is expected to be out in fall 2020, at which point we’ll all either be feeling cautiously hopeful or devastated and terrified—both emotional states that call for a good book!
